Abstract

A method for producing scratch-off lottery tickets in a high speed printing line is provided, wherein the printing line includes one or more inkjet printing machines that print lottery tickets on a continuously running paper stock. One or more primer layers are applied to a surface of the paper stock in a defined game play area on each lottery ticket. With the inkjet printing machines game play indicia is printed over the primer layers in the game play area on each lottery ticket at a resolution of at least 600 dpi. The running paper stock is conveyed through the inkjet printing machines at a rate of at least 950 ft./min. The ink jet printing machines use a specially formulated dye-based ink.

Claims (78)

1. A method for producing scratch-off lottery tickets in a high speed printing line, wherein the printing line includes one or more inkjet printing machines that print lottery tickets on a continuously running paper stock, the method comprising:

applying one or more primer layers to a surface of the paper stock in a defined game play area on each lottery ticket,

with one or more of the inkjet printing machining, printing game play indicia over the primer layers in the game play area on each lottery ticket at a resolution of at least 600 dpi;

conveying the running paper stock through the one or more inkjet printing machines that print the game play indicia at a rate of at least 950 ft/min;

applying an upper blocking layer over the game play indicia;

applying a scratch off coating (SOC) layer over the upper blocking layer;

printing graphics on each lottery ticket outwardly of the game play area;

wherein ink used by ink jet printing machines is a dye-based ink comprising:

a solids content of no more than 10.00% by weight;

a humectant content of more than 1.00% by weight;

a slow-evaporating solvent content of no more than 1.00% by weight;

a fast-evaporating solvent content of at least 1.00% by weight; and

a water resistant polymer content of at least 5.00% by weight; and

wherein the primer layer on which the game play indicia is printed comprises:

a plastics pigment content of 15.0 to 25.0% by weight;

an opaque polymer content of 8.0 to 15.0% by weight;

a hydrophilic silica content of 0.50 to 1.50% by weight;

a resolubility additive content of 5.0 to 15% by weight;

a plasticizer content of 2.0 to 6.0% by weight; and

a surfactant content of 1.0 to 3.0% by weight.

2. The method as in claim 1 , wherein the running paper stock is conveyed through the one or more inkjet printing machines that print the game play indicia at a rate of about 975 ft./min.

3. The method as in claim 1 , wherein the graphics are printed by one or more inkjet printing machines at a resolution of at least 600 dpi and at a rate of at least 950 ft./min.

4. The method as in claim 3 , further comprising printing graphics over the SOC layer at a resolution of at least 600 dpi and at a rate of at least 950 ft./min.

5. The method as in claim 1 , wherein the humectant content comprises sodium hydroxide and dimethylaminoethanol in about equal amounts by weight.

6. The method as in claim 1 , wherein the slow evaporating solvent is benzyl alcohol.

7. The method as in claim 1 , wherein the fast-evaporating solvent is dimethylaminoethanol.
